Chapter 357 - Chapter 357: Thousand Faces Who Hasn’t Given Up

Silas did not mention this matter to Steven.

After all, the two of them had only just met today.

Even if he were to ask someone about it, it should be Professor Owen or Professor Oak, not Steven.

Steven continued speaking. "As for so-called Z-Moves, you can think of them as enhanced, upgraded versions of regular moves. To activate them, aside from a Z-Ring, you also need something called a Z-Crystal.

Z-Crystals only exist in special mineral veins in the Alola region.

There are many types, corresponding to each elemental type and certain specific Pokémon. To use a Z-Move, a Trainer must wear a Z-Ring embedded with a Z-Crystal on their wrist, and have their Pokémon hold a matching Z-Crystal to create resonance.

The Trainer's stamina and physical strength are also heavily consumed during this process.

The Pokémon League is currently considering the possibility of using Z-Rings for Mega Evolution as well.

However, regardless of whether it's the former or the latter, neither can realistically be put into use in the short term, at the very least, it's a ten-year project."

At the end of the day, Steven was still a Trainer.

Although he was obsessed with stones, when it came to Pokémon battles, he took things very seriously.

Silas nodded.

With that explanation, he more or less understood.

It was essentially shifting the enhancement provided by Mega Evolution from the Pokémon itself to its moves instead.

A Z-Ring and Z-Crystal were roughly equivalent to a Key Stone and Mega Stone.

That said, this made the system much friendlier to ordinary Pokémon and Trainers.

After all, only a small number of Pokémon can Mega Evolve.

But from what Steven described, it seemed that most moves could potentially be turned into Z-Moves.

Still, just as Steven said, this ability would not be applied to standard Pokémon battles in the near future.

There were many reasons.

The most important was a lack of data.

This included stamina consumption, duration, power, and the effects of individual moves.

Without these, Z-Moves could not be officially approved.

Another issue was the many major and minor requirements involved in producing Z-Rings.

After all, the Pokémon League had only discovered Alola fairly recently.

Everything was still in the exploratory stage.

Even so, the Sparkling Stone was still extremely valuable. Putting aside legendary Pokémon power, the raw material used to make Z-Rings came from it. It looked like something that needed to be carefully preserved.

Sooner or later, it would definitely be useful.

Steven looked at the thoughtful Silas, a strange smile appearing at the corner of his mouth.

Everything he had said was correct, he had only left out one not-so-small key detail.

He was very much looking forward to the day Silas would release his first Z-Move.

It would certainly be an interesting sight.

After all, it had taken Steven himself quite a long time to accept the truth back then.

Fortunately, there was no immediate need to use such a move yet.

The two chatted a bit longer.

"It's getting late. I'll head back to rest."

Silas checked the time and stood up to take his leave.

"Alright. Don't forget to send me the list."

Steven didn't keep him any longer.

It really was late.

He even kindly reminded Silas, worried that he might forget about the transaction.

"I won't, I won't."

Silas responded readily, there was no way he could forget something this important.

This concerned his quality of life for the next half year or more.

Returning to the Pokémon Center.

Because of the exchange convention, Leaf City's Pokémon Center and the Nurse Joys inside were still working overtime.

The building was brightly lit even at this hour.

Of course, don't even think about trading Pokémon here at most, you could do item exchanges.

Otherwise, Nurse Joy would teach you what "loving education" really meant.

In the bustling lobby, a bloated, obese man sat on a sofa, panting heavily, looking as if he were exhausted from attending events all day.

However, his narrowed eyes were secretly locked onto Silas.

"So this guy even has ties to Steven…"

Thousand Faces hesitated.

He had followed Silas all day and had clearly seen the target walking together with Hoenn Champion Steven Stone at the battle venue.

The two were even close enough that Steven invited him back to his home.

Thousand Faces had seen it with his own eyes.

As a member of Team Magma, he knew better than most just how terrifying Steven was.

That man was a true monster.

And yet, Thousand Faces was unwilling to give up so easily.

"This guy is way too cautious."

He felt genuinely wounded.

The target was clearly just someone who had recently come of age, yet his actions were extremely steady and careful.

The Tauros Chase event in the afternoon, as well as the battles, had been perfect opportunities.

Thousand Faces knew that the target had only brought along a seemingly ordinary Ralts.

But the problem was that the target was always positioned right at the center of the crowd. If he made a move, countless people would see it.

Thousand Faces had no desire to be beaten into a pulp by a mob, so he could only wait and watch. As for discovering that the other party's background wasn't simple?

So what?

He had offended people like that plenty of times before.

Thousand Faces only cared whether his operation succeeded.

Besides, he'd heard that Blaise had already been caught with solid evidence and locked up. For the time being, there was nothing for him to do.

Thinking of this, Thousand Faces felt nothing but disdain.

A short-lived fool will always be a short-lived fool. No sense of vigilance at all and he still managed to get caught with evidence.

What a disgrace to dark organizations everywhere.

With that thought, the fat man Thousand Faces slowly trailed behind Silas and entered the residential area.

Silas was completely unaware.

It wasn't that he didn't know someone was behind him, people like Thousand Faces were simply too common.

Mixed into the crowd, even with his keen perception, Silas couldn't sense anything unusual.

"Bang"

Watching the door close, the fat Thousand Faces let out a cold chuckle.

He refused to believe that this guy could stay alert forever.

As long as Silas relaxed, he would have his chance.

Before that, though, he might as well get some proper rest.

Lying on the bed, Thousand Faces was filled with resentment. If it weren't for that idiot, he wouldn't be this exhausted.

The Next Morning

Silas set out early, walking along the road in a great mood.

Why?

Naturally, it was because after he sent his list of requirements to Steven the previous night, the speed at which the other party paid exceeded all expectations.

To be precise, it wasn't money, but breeding materials.

One could only say that a large corporation really lived up to its name; everything Silas needed had been prepared overnight.

According to Steven, once Silas reached Goldenrod City, he could simply pick everything up at the Devon Corporation counter inside the department store.

That was unbelievably convenient.

Silas felt that Steven was truly a friend worth keeping.

"Mm-hmm~ ♪"

Humming an unknown tune, he headed straight toward the forest.

This was the shortest route to the next town.

"This guy… is he insane?"

Trailing behind, Thousand Faces's expression changed repeatedly.

He even began to wonder whether Silas had already noticed him.

"Or maybe, I should wait ahead?"

Watching Silas disappear into the forest ahead, Thousand Faces didn't dare follow directly, instead choosing to take a detour.

By the roadside, an extremely inconspicuous wooden sign stood quietly—

"Ursaring Forest EXTREME DANGER

DO NOT ENTER"
